The Florida Department of Education announced Brandy Nicole Anderson, a teacher at Indian Trails Middle School in Flagler County, as one of five finalists for the 2026 Florida Teacher of the Year. The state finalists were chosen from 76 district teachers of the year.

Earth Day, an annual event dedicated to environmental protection, is today—Tuesday, April 22, 2025and marks its 55th anniversary.

What began as a national movement in the United States in 1970 has blossomed globally. Earth Day is coordinated by earthday.org, which unites over a billion individuals across more than 192 countries.

To help ensure the safety and well-being of our students, Flagler Schools is requiring all high school students wanting to participate in athletics, JROTC, Marching Band, or Color Guard to complete a one-time electrocardiogram (ECG) prior to participation.
